The Bahia-Minas Railway was a Brazilian railway company that connected the Jequitinhonha Valley in northeastern Minas Gerais to the southern coast of Bahia. Inaugurated on January 25, 1881 and deactivated in 1966, it spanned 578 kilometers, linking the Minas Gerais municipality of Aracuai to the district of Ponta de Areia in Caravelas on the extreme southern coast of Bahia, where its tracks reached a port, and it played a crucial role in the regional economy.
